PUSC demands the government to start roadworks on Route 32

August 2, 2016 by Staff News Writer

Luis Vásquez, legislator from the Social Christian Unity Party (PUSC) demanded the government to give the order to start the expansion and improvement of Route 32 this month.

According to the legislator, President Luis Guillermo Solís should commit to solve this and other problems afflicting Limón to reach concrete results on August 31st, Day of Afro-Costa Rican Culture.

Vásquez said that the achievements the Government keeps mentioning

are just numbers they repeat over and over again, things that are not tangible for people from Limón,”

and added that Solís’ administration should commit to building a new hospital for the province and to improve Cieneguita airport.
